Windows and Doors: A Comprehensive Guide to Selection, Maintenance, and Trends
Windows and doors play a crucial function in both the aesthetic appeal and performance of a home. They act as barriers against the components, offer security, and produce openings for ventilation and light. Understanding the various types, materials, and maintenance practices connected with windows and doors can considerably enhance a property's worth and convenience.

Selecting Windows and Doors
Materials to Consider
- Wood: Known for its aesthetics, wood is a standard choice however requires routine upkeep.
- Vinyl: This product is low upkeep and energy-efficient, resisting peeling and fading.
- Aluminum: Durable and lightweight, aluminum windows and doors are perfect for contemporary styles.
- Fiberglass: Highly durable and energy-efficient, fiberglass can mimic wood without the upkeep.
Energy Efficiency Ratings
When choosing windows and doors, energy efficiency is crucial. Search for:
- U-Factor: Measures the rate of heat transfer. Lower values are better.
-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C): Indicates how well a product blocks heat from sunshine. Lower worths are chosen in warm environments.
- Visible Transmittance (VT): Assesses just how much light travel through. Greater worths permit more light.

Upkeep Tips
To extend the life of windows and doors, regular upkeep is important. Here are some handy pointers:
- Cleaning: Use moderate cleaning agent and soft cloths for cleaning up glass surface areas.
- Sealing: Check seals around doors and windows annually to prevent air leaks.
- Lubrication: Apply silicone spray to hinges, locks, and sliding systems frequently.
- Examination: Look for signs of wetness damage, wear, or decay, especially in wood fixtures.
